Moccamaster

POSITIVES

  • Great build quality. Made from completely recyclable but strong materials including steel, aluminium, plastic and glass make it completely BPA free.
  • Improved design on previous models that includes a thermal steel flask that can retain heat and keep coffee tasting good for an hour before going noticeably stale.
  • Quick brew time. The KBGT can produce 10 cups worth of coffee in bulk (1.2 litres) that can be brewed within a fast 6 minutes due to an effective copper heat element.
  • Clever design. The KBGT can keep accurately boiled water at temperatures of 92-96 degrees for a consistent and ideal brewing temperature. An automatic drip stop function also restricts spillage from the brew basket when brewing or when the steel flask is removed for pouring.
  • Highly automated. Literally add the water and coffee grounds and away you go.
  • The Moccamaster KBGT has been certificatied by a speciality coffee governing body AKA the Speciality Coffee Association (SCA).
  • Every model comes with a 5 year warranty for consumer confidence.

 

NEGATIVES

  • Priced in excess of £190 may seem expensive to some and for home brewing for one this could be deemed as overkill.
  • As with many electrical metal coffee brew systems (Espresso machines included) they require maintenance. That being said Moccamaster replacement parts are easily accessible.
  • Potential room for improvement. As much as the thermal flask does its job retaining heat when sealed, an air pot insulated thermal flask can retain heat as as well pour coffee. Take note Moccamaster.
